Manuel White (UCLA) - 2005 NFL Draft Pick #120 by WAS
What The Experts Thought Before The Draft
Pre-Draft Analysis for Manuel White - 2005 NFL Draft
Player Profile:
- Name: Manuel White
- Position: Running Back
- College: UCLA
Physical Attributes:
- Height: 6'2"
- Weight: 240 lbs
- Speed: Good straight-line speed for a back of his size
Strengths:
- Powerful runner with the ability to break tackles.
- Good size and strength make him a formidable presence in short-yardage situations.
- Has experience in a pro-style offense at UCLA, which should ease the transition to the NFL.
- Decent hands for a running back, showing the ability to contribute in the passing game.
Weaknesses:
- Inconsistent vision; at times, struggles to find running lanes.
- Limited agility and speed compared to smaller, quicker backs.
- Injury history could raise concerns for durability over a long NFL season.
Overall Assessment:
Manuel White is viewed as a power back who can contribute effectively in short-yardage and goal-line situations. His size and strength make him an attractive option for teams looking for a physical runner. However, concerns about his agility and vision may limit his effectiveness as an every-down back. Teams may see him as a solid backup or situational player, with potential for development if he can improve his decision-making and overall running style.
Projected Draft Round: 3rd to 5th Round
